Clear- Outdoor: They have waterproof protection, which makes them capable of functioning in an outdoor environment without being affected by weather conditions.
- Wi-Fi: Wireless transmission and reception of data, without the need for cables, other than for power supply.
- 4G: Sending and receiving data via mobile network.
- Mobile App: They can connect with a smartphone through an application, which gives the user the ability to manage the cameras wherever they are.
- Memory Card Slot: Ability to insert a memory card for immediate video recording.
- Motion Detection: With the ability to record or send notifications when the camera detects motion in the area.
- Built-in Microphone: Besides the image, they can also record sound.
- Robotic PTZ: It has the ability to rotate and zoom from a distance through an application.
- Rotating: With remote rotation capability, allowing control of more areas within the installation space.
- Wide Angle Lens: The wide angle lens has a larger horizontal field of view (110 degrees and above), allowing it to capture a wider area of the image.
- Thermal: Thermal technology allows the camera to create images based on temperature differences between objects and their surroundings.
- 720p: Basic resolution, more suitable for small spaces with limited requirements. Provides satisfactory image quality for general monitoring but does not capture details, especially at long distances.
- Full HD: Provides good image clarity of faces or objects at close or medium range. Suitable for home use and small businesses.
- 3MP: It offers better image clarity compared to 1080p cameras and is suitable for areas where more detail is needed, such as entrances or access and control points.
- 4MP: High resolution with clear image at medium distances, suitable for monitoring stores, yards, or parking areas.
- 5MP: Even higher clarity compared to 4MP cameras, with the ability to clearly capture faces or license plates. Useful for professional and large spaces where detail is important.
- 6MP: It offers excellent image clarity in large areas such as warehouses or courtyards, where you need to see clearly without image distortion.
- 4K: Top resolution with exceptionally clear image and detail, even from a distance. Suitable for critical monitoring points and public areas with increased surveillance needs.
- Battery: They have a built-in rechargeable battery or solar panel without requiring a connection to electricity.
- Solar Panel: It features a panel that allows for charging its battery through solar energy.
- PoE: Power over Ethernet (PoE) capability
- IP: Network cameras that connect to the area's network either wired or wirelessly.
- CCTV: Analog cameras that are connected to a closed circuit exclusively set up for them, where data is transferred only through wired connections.
- Dome: Cameras with a discreet design, which generally have increased durability, as their lens is located within the housing.
- Bullet / Box: Clear cameras with a wide range of capture, suitable for large indoor and outdoor spaces.
- Tabletop: Cameras with the ability to be placed on any surface. They are usually intended for home use and have a high aesthetic design.
- Color: Captures color images in low light conditions or at night.
- Infrared: They have infrared LED lights, allowing them to capture black and white images in low light conditions or in the dark.
- Digital: Digital zoom enlarges the image electronically by cropping and expanding the pixels. This function is suitable for smaller areas with lower detail requirements.
- Optics: Optical zoom enlarges the image by moving the camera lens. In this way, it offers higher image quality and detail compared to digital zoom.
- Number of Cameras: The number of lenses that a camera may have in the same body for better visual coverage of the area.
- Google Home: Compatibility of the camera with smart devices that work through the Google Home app.
- Apple HomeKit: Camera compatibility with smart devices that work through the Apple Home app.
- Alexa: Compatibility of the camera with smart devices that work through the Alexa app.
